In an era marked by rapid industrialization and shifting social norms, "Memoirs of a Millionaire" by Lucia True Ames Mead delves into the complexities of wealth and responsibility. The story follows Mildred Brewster, a young woman who inherits a substantial fortune, presenting her with both thrilling opportunities and daunting challenges. As she grapples with her newfound status, themes of personal integrity and societal expectations emerge, highlighting the tension between individual desires and communal duties. This compelling narrative invites students and civic activists to explore the implications of affluence and the moral dilemmas it entails. With its rich character development and thought-provoking scenarios, this novel remains a relevant exploration of wealth's impact on identity and society.
